Gary's Still Got It

As you probably already know, Coach Gary Williams underwent surgery earlier this month to repair a disc problem in his back. It came as a shock to most fans, since he appeared unscathed at Midnight Madness, and not many knew about it then. But at yesterday's Halloween scrimmage (where Vasquez dominated, of course) Gary donned a neckbrace. Think that at all slowed him down on the sidelines? Heck no! Gary was still red in the face, with facial veins throbbing while doing his classic two-hands-on-his-head-as-if-the-world-were-ending stance.

Players played impressively. Freshman Jordan Williams looked pretty solid on the court and appears to be a promising player. Good thing charges of pushing a girl to the ground were dropped. The last thing we need is a good player in bad trouble.
